Chef Bob Aungst Teamed Up With Ivanhoe Park Brewing Company & Lombardi’s Seafood for Cold Smoked Oysters and Beer Flights – Summer of 2019’s Most Unique Happy Hour

Chef Bob Aungst, Lombardi’s Seafood and Ivanhoe Park Brewing Company hosted a one-of-a-kind happy hour at Ivanhoe Park Brewing Co. on Thursday, June 6. Guests enjoyed raw oysters, fresh from Lombardi’s Seafood, and cold smoked by Chef Bob for a sensational new flavor profile. They were paired with four of Ivanhoe Park’s favorite brews, and two of the four were also cold smoked. 

Guests in the VIP section experienced a live cold smoking demo and sampled additional items that were also cold smoked at the VIP tables. Pangea Shellfish Company assisted Lombardi’s in sourcing boutique oysters from New Zealand, Rhode Island, and Maine. The three varieties were incredibly unique, each with distinctive textures and flavors. They were also much larger than typical varieties and were a huge hit with the oyster loving guests!

About the Hosts of Half Shells + Half Pints

Chef Bob Aungst handcrafts culinary experiences for lovers of food and spirits. He’s based in Central Florida, and travels worldwide to serve celebrities, political leaders, professional athletes, VIPs, and luxury brands at large and small scale events.

Ivanhoe Park Brewing Company is an independent craft brewery and tasting room located in the historic Ivanhoe District of Orlando, Florida. Ivanhoe Park Brewing Company celebrates the spirit and pioneering ways of early 20th century Lake Ivanhoe founder George I. Russell. Later named Joyland, an amusement and recreational park located on the shores of Lake Ivanhoe, Ivanhoe Park previously served as home to beautifully lined orange groves and a pineapple farm.
